Tightly is about empowering omnichannel brands to master their inventory—and their cash flow. We are the Inventory Planning & Purchasing Intelligence Platform built for the complexity of modern commerce. With a culture that is all-in on impact, innovation, and customer obsession, Tightly is the sweet spot for building big, moving fast, and taking supply chain technology—and your career—to the next level.

In this role, you will be the technical engine behind our sales process. You don’t need to come in as a retail expert—we will teach you the intricacies of the supply chain. What we need from you is the technical intuition to navigate data challenges and the confidence to guide customers through critical Pilots and Proofs of Concept (PoCs).

Tightly sits as the intelligence layer on top of a merchant's ERP and sales channels. Your job is to ensure that the data translation is flawless. You will work with prospective customers to validate their inputs, using your technical toolkit (SQL, Python, AI) to troubleshoot anomalies and ensure that the purchasing plans Tightly generates are based on accurate, clean signals.

  • Lead Technical Pilots & PoCs: Own the most critical phase of the sales cycle. You will guide the prospect through the data ingestion process, ensuring the Tightly platform accurately models their business logic before the deal is closed.
  • Bridge the Data Gap: While our platform handles the heavy lifting, you will use your technical skills (SQL, Python) to troubleshoot edge cases. If a customer's data format doesn’t match the system of record, you find the fix to unblock the deal.
  • You will use modern tools like Claude and Gemini to write quick scripts, debug data errors, or analyse file structures, allowing you to move faster than a traditional engineer.
  • You will explain to stakeholders how Tightly interprets their historical data to create a reliable forecast, giving them the confidence to trust our recommendations.

Master the Domain: We will teach you retail. You will learn how global brands decide what to buy, how they manage capital efficiency, and how to model purchasing constraints.

  • Technical Fluency (SQL & Python): You aren’t building the product, but you know how to interrogate data. If a customer’s export is messy, you can write a quick script or query to diagnose the issue and fix it rather than waiting for Engineering.
  • When a Pilot data set looks "off," you have the curiosity to dig in, find the discrepancy, and resolve it using the tools at your disposal.
  • Customer-Facing Comfort: You are comfortable presenting on Zoom, managing a room, and translating technical data concepts into business value for non-technical humans.
  • AI Literacy: You are comfortable using LLMs to speed up your own workflows, whether that’s formatting data or drafting technical responses.

The Science of Inventory Planning: We don’t expect you to know "Open-to-Buy" formulas or supply chain constraints on Day 1. Our team works to ensure that the intelligence we provide is accessible, usable, and mathematically sound.
